Yield: 2 smoothie bowls
Â
Ingredients
Smoothie
1 frozen banana
1 cup ripe mango
1 ripe avocado
1.5 cups dairy-free milk (coconut, almond, etc.)
2 large handfuls fresh baby spinach
1 scoop Riza-Max Organic Brown Rice Protein
1 scoop VegeGreens by Progressive
Â
Optional Toppings
- fresh berries
- minced pineapple
- shelled hemp seeds
- raw cacao nibs
- chopped almonds
- chia seed
- shredded or flaked unsweetened coconut
- goji berries
- bee pollen
- pomegranate seeds
Â
Â
Directions
- Place smoothie ingredients in blender and blend until smooth. Use a tamper as needed to push the ingredients down to ensure mixture is fully blended.
- Add small amounts of extra dairy-free milk as necessary. Aim for a smooth but thick consistency.
- Divide smoothie into two bowls.
- Adorn the smoothie bowl with desired toppings. Have fun with it and get creative!
- Dig in!
